From the Reception Hall the carpeted staircase rises to:
FIRST FLOOR LANDING Built-in shelved store cupboard, doors arranged off to:
BEDROOM 1 13' 4" x 12' 4" (4.08m x 3.77m) maximum into the UPVC window to the front elevation Fitted carpet, coved cornice, radiator, ceiling light.
BEDROOM 2 13' 3" x 11' 8" (4.05m x 3.57m) Fitted carpet, UPVC window to the rear elevation, radiator, ceiling light, coved cornice.
BEDROOM 3 9' 4" x 7' 3" (2.87m x 2.22m) Fitted carpet, UPVC window to the front elevation, coved cornice, radiator.
SHOWER ROOM 8' 0" x 8' 3" (2.46m x 2.54m) Fitted shower cabinet, pedestal wash hand basin, low level WC, half tiled walls, vertical radiator/towel rail, ceiling light, access to loft space, extractor fan, obscure glazed UPVC window.
EXTERIOR The house itself has ample off-road parking to the gravelled frontage and has an established rear garden with patio, gravelled area, lawn, stocked borders, 2 apple trees and oil tank.
BUILDING PLOT NO. 1 To the left hand side (south) of the property as viewed from the road is a building plot. The plot has Outline Planning Permission for a detached property.
To the right hand side (north) is the:-
FORMER GARAGE PREMISES Comprising a:
DETACHED BRICK WORKSHOP Approximately 14m width x 8m depth with twin roller doors, rear and side windows, concrete floor, power and lighting.
There is a further garden area behind the workshop and this would constitute the:
SECOND BUILDING PLOT Subject to demolition of the workshop.
SERVICES Mains water and electricity. Oil central heating. Private drainage (we understand the private drainage system is currently located within the first building plot - to the south side of the property) and the prospective buyers will be responsible for supplying necessary services to the existing house and the 2 plots in accordance with the planning conditions.
GENERAL INFORMATION Situated on the southern outskirts of the popular village of Gedney Hill, the property comprises a detached house with former village garage, workshop premises and is sold with the benefit of the current Planning Consent (as noted on page 1). A site plan is included within the particulars giving prospective buyers an indication as to the potential on offer - ideal for a developer/multi generational family/potential business use subject to planning consent.
